EMT Hit By Vehicle, Killed While Working Traffic Accident
By: Stephen Crews
Updated: December 15, 2010
EMT Laura Elizabeth Pullam, 29, of Lowndesboro was on the scene of a two-vehicle crash around 9:00am on I-65 south at the 161 mile marker near Hope Hull when the vehicle hit her.
Sgt. Steve Jarrett with the Alabama State Troopers said that while Pullam was rendering aid to the victim of a crash, a 2006 Chevrolet pick-up truck left the roadway and struck her.
Pullam was rushed to Baptist South Hospital.
There were many crashes across the northern two-thirds of the state today due to icy conditions caused by freezing rain.
